Description
Butyltris[[2-[(2-Ethyl-1-Oxohexyl)Oxy]Ethyl]Thio]Stannane is a specialized organotin compound, a key intermediate in advanced material synthesis. This chemical matters for its role as a precursor and catalyst in high-performance polymer and coating formulations, offering precise reactivity control. It is primarily needed by manufacturers in the polymer, specialty chemical, and advanced materials industries for applications requiring tailored thermal and mechanical properties.
Application
- Polymer Stabilizer: Acts as a heat stabilizer and catalyst in the production of PVC and other halogenated polymers.
- Crosslinking Agent: Used in silicone rubber (RTV) and polyurethane systems to control cure rates and enhance final product properties.
- Catalyst Intermediate: Serves as a precursor for other organotin catalysts used in esterification and transesterification reactions.
- Specialty Coatings: Imparts specific performance characteristics in high-temperature and corrosion-resistant industrial coatings.
- Adhesive Formulations: Employed to modify the curing profile and adhesion strength in structural and specialty adhesives.
- Research & Development: A valuable reagent for synthesizing novel organometallic complexes and exploring new catalytic pathways.
